Dashboard UI Polish / Mobile Responsive Upgrade

Changed:
- Reorganized scoreboard dashboard into clean Live Hero, Preview, Runs, Extras, Wickets, Match Setup, Live Tools, Next Innings, End/Reset sections.
- Mobile-first responsive layout with horizontal top navigation and sticky control tabs.
- Larger run buttons for easy touch operation on mobile.
- Extras and wickets remain connected to the smart scoring modal logic.
- Existing scoring functions/API calls are unchanged.
- Overlay design and animation logic are unchanged.

Updated files:
- partials/scoreboard_panel.php
- assets/css/dashboard.css
- assets/js/core.js
